SPM10040T-220M-HZR by TDK

SPM10040T-220M-HZR by TDK is a shielded, surface mount fixed inductor with 22uH nominal inductance. It has a max rated current of 3.8A and operates b/w -40 to 125°C. Ideal for power applications, this general purpose inductor features dual-ended terminals and wraparound shape in a compact rectangular package.

TDK was founded as a venture enterprise in 1935 for the purpose of industrializing a magnetic material called ferrite, which was invented at the Tokyo Institute of Technology. TDK's corporate motto is "Contribute to culture and industry through creativity," a message that embodies the company's founding spirit. Guided by this spirit, in the ensuing year TDK has sought to refine its materials and process technologies, as it develops new products that satisfy market needs. Concurrently, TDK advances globalization and diversification of its business operation while actively pursuing M&As, collaboration with external partners and other initiatives. As a result, TDK today is engaged in four main businesses: Passive Components, Sensor Application Products, Magnetic Application Products, and Energy Application Products.
